Manchester United defender Jonny Evans could stay at the club longer than initially expected, as discussions for his contract extension have commenced.

The 36-year-old Northern Ireland international returned to United last summer from Leicester City, eight years after his first departure from Old Trafford.

Jonny Evans initially joined United during pre-season training to maintain his fitness. However, his impressive performance under manager Erik ten Hag earned him a one-year deal.

During the last season, Evans made 30 appearances, including a substitute appearance in the FA Cup final win against Manchester City at Wembley.

The club have confirmed that they are also in talks with goalkeeper Tom Heaton regarding a new deal and have offered a contract to 19-year-old forward Omari Forson.

Forson made his Premier League debut in February’s 4-3 win against Wolves, providing the assist for Kobbie Mainoo’s winning goal at Molineux. Despite making six further appearances, Forson has yet to be persuaded to sign a new deal at the club.

If Evans’ contract extension goes through, he will remain one of the most experienced players at Manchester United, providing valuable guidance to the club’s younger talents.

With 379 Premier League appearances, Evans is considered one of the most seasoned defenders in England. He has made an impressive 228 appearances for Manchester United, scoring seven goals and providing seven assists.
